2026-02-07 09:20:10
在信息技术飞速发展的今天,区块链作为一项颠覆传统的技术,正在全球范围内引起广泛关注。区块链不仅促进了数字货币的发展,还为各行各业的创新提供了新的思路与技术支持。了解区块链软件的基础知识,对于现代用户而言至关重要。
区块链是一个去中心化的分布式数据库,信息以“区块”的形式存储,并通过密码学技术实现数据的完整性和不可篡改性。每个区块通过链式结构与前一个区块相连,这种设计确保了数据的安全性。了解这些基本概念,有助于抓住区块链技术的精髓。
区块链软件可以根据其功能进行分类,包括钱包软件、节点软件、平台软件以及去中心化应用(DApps)。每种软件在区块链生态中扮演着不同的角色,满足不同用户的需求。
区块链的核心技术包含多个方面,如哈希算法、共识机制和加密技术。通过这些技术,区块链能够保障自身的安全性、可靠性和去中心化特性。
区块链的应用范围极其广泛,从金融服务到供应链管理,再到物联网和数字身份保护。其多样化的应用场景展示了区块链的巨大潜力与价值。
尽管区块链技术发展迅速,但在普及过程中仍面临着可扩展性、交易速度与成本、以及监管合规等诸多挑战。只有解决这些问题,才能更好地推动区块链的发展。
随着技术的进步,区块链将与人工智能等新兴技术结合,发展出更多新的应用场景。隐私保护与行业标准化也将成为未来区块链发展的重要趋势。
在数字化时代,掌握区块链软件的基础知识,不仅能帮助用户更好地理解这一前沿技术,也为参与相关行业的创新与发展奠定基础。
--- ### 七个相关问题及详细介绍区块链的安全性主要依靠密码学技术、去中心化结构和共识机制。每个区块的数据都通过哈希算法进行加密,任何对区块内容的修改都将导致其哈希值发生变化,这种特性确保了区块数据的不可篡改性。此外,去中心化结构使得没有单一的控制点,极大降低了数据被攻击的风险。而共识机制(如工作量证明和权益证明)则确保了网络中的各个节点对交易的有效性达成一致,从而防止“双花”现象的发生。
共识机制确保区块链网络中参与者对数据真实性达成共识。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)、委任权益证明(DPoS)等。PoW以计算能力为基础,节点通过解决复杂数学问题获得区块奖励;而PoS则根据持币数量与时间选择节点进行打包,鼓励持币者维护网络安全。DPoS则通过选举代表节点的方式提高交易速度与效率。每种机制都有其优缺点,选择适合的共识机制是区块链项目成功的关键。
去中心化应用(DApp)的开发过程相对传统应用有独特的特点。首先,需要选择一个合适的区块链平台,如以太坊、EOS等,这些平台提供了智能合约的支持。其次,开发者需编写智能合约代码,使用编程语言(如Solidity)进行逻辑设计。智能合约在区块链上自动执行合约条款,无需第三方介入。最后,将DApp前端与后端智能合约进行连接,使用Web3.js等库进行交互,实现去中心化的应用体验。了解DApp的开发过程,有助于开发者把握区块链技术的应用潜力。
区块链在金融行业的应用场景极为丰富,主要包括支付结算、跨境支付、供应链金融、数字资产等。在支付结算方面,区块链实现了低延迟、低成本的实时交易,极大提高了效益。在跨境支付中,区块链提供透明和安全的交易记录,减少了中介环节和费用。此外,通过区块链技术,传统金融机构能够创新融资模式,如供应链金融通过智能合约对接各方,提高资金周转效率。随着对区块链的深入理解,金融行业将焕发新的活力。
区块链技术的广泛应用正在对传统产业产生深远影响。比如在供应链管理中,通过使用区块链技术,可以实现商品从生产到销售各个环节的透明追踪,减少假冒伪劣商品的出现。在医药行业,借助区块链,药品的流通和来源可被确切追溯,降低了药品安全风险。农业领域通过区块链实现农产品的来源追踪与认证,提升消费者的信任度。总体来说,传统产业通过区块链实现了更高的透明度与效率,大幅提升了运营效果和用户体验。
区块链的发展依然面对诸多技术挑战。首先,可扩展性问题是当前最为关注的议题之一,尤其是在交易量大时,网络处理速度可能会受到限制,导致交易延迟。其次,成本问题,尤其是使用PoW机制的区块链,挖矿所需的计算资源消耗巨大,导致能源消耗和经济效率低下。此外,技术的复杂性和普及程度也影响了区块链的应用。在监管方面,不同国家和地区对区块链技术的监管政策差异较大,这也给区块链的发展带来了不确定性。只有有效解决以上问题,区块链才能更好地融入社会经济活动中。
区块链的未来发展趋势展现出多个方向,首先是与人工智能的结合,二者的结合将会在数据处理、智能合约等领域产生重大变革。其次,隐私保护技术的进步将会提高用户数据的安全性,这对区块链的广泛应用至关重要。例如,零知识证明(ZKP)技术能够在不透露任何用户信息的情况下验证事务。第三,行业标准化与互操作性将促进各区块链平台之间的交流与合作,从而形成更大的生态系统。随着技术的成熟,区块链将会在更多行业得到应用,提升生产效率与服务质量。
--- 以上是围绕“区块链软件基础知识”的内容大纲及详细介绍。这部分内容系统性地介绍了区块链的基础知识与发展情况,同时围绕关键问题提供了深入分析,为读者提供了一个全面的视角。